Jaime C. González

Chairman and CEO
Hong Kong — Manila

Mr. González founded AO Capital Partners in 1988 and has been the Chairman/CEO of the Group since its inception. Previously, he was Managing Director of Shearson Lehman Brothers (Asia) Inc. where he was overseeing its investment banking activities in the Asia Pacific region.

From 1983 to 1986, Mr. González served as the Special Trade Negotiator (equivalent rank of Deputy Minister) of the Ministry of Trade and Industry of the Philippines. Concurrently, he was Vice Chairman and President of Philippine International Trading Corporation (International trading arm of the Philippines government). Mr. González has extensive experience in and dedicates much of his time to strategic advisory and principal investments as well as public and private financings.

As Chairman of AO Capital, Mr. González has executed numerous transactions across a wide range of industries in Asia and in the process acquired unmatched relationships with the blue-chip companies and well-respected groups in Asia.

Mr. González is active in socio cultural organizations such as the Philippine Map Collectors Society where he is the President, the World President’s Organization Philippine Chapter, Harvard Club New York Chapter, Philippine Institute of Certified Public Accountants, and the International Wine and Food Society.

Mr. González is the Vice Chairman and President of Arthaland Corporation, a highly respected property development company in the Philippines whose portfolio consists entirely of sustainable developments. He has also served in the boards of a number of publicly listed companies including Euromoney Institutional Investor PLC (a leading international media group focused primarily on the international finance sector listed in the London Stock Exchange) and the Southeast Asia Cement Holdings, Inc. (a subsidiary of Lafarge S.A.).

Mr. González is a graduate of Harvard Business School (MBA) and of De La Salle University in Manila (B.A. in Economics (cum laude) and B.S. in Commerce (cum laude)). Mr. González is a Certified Public Accountant (Philippines).

Omar Salvo

Managing Director
Manila

Omar Salvo leads AO Capital’s restructuring and work-outs practice, and also heads the firm’s asset servicing operations. He is a 30-year banking and finance veteran with extensive experience in corporate and investment banking, as well as in asset recovery.

Before joining AOCP in 2006, he was the First Vice President of the Asset Recovery Group of the Land Bank of the Philippines where he led the management and disposition of over US$300.0 Million worth of Land Bank’s non-performing assets. He also previously set up and headed the Bank’s Corporate Finance Department, leading the origination and execution of various financial advisory, loan syndication, restructuring, and debt and equity underwriting transactions. Landbank is the 2nd largest bank in the Philippines in terms of total assets as of March 2021.

Mr. Salvo has served on the boards of both going-concern as well as under-rehab corporations including Arthaland Corporation, Land Bank Realty and Development Corporation, All Asia Capital, Paper Industries Corporation of the Philippines, the Subic Yacht Club, and various condominium corporations, among others.

He holds a Master in Business Management (“MBM”) degree from the Asian Institute of Management and an AB Economics from the Ateneo de Manila University.

Srinivas Polishetty

Managing Director
Manila — Hyderabad

Srini has over 30 years of investment banking and private equity experience in Asia with AIA Capital-Blackstone JV and American Orient Capital Partners, a boutique investment firm focused on long term investments in Asia Pacific region.

Srini was formerly partner of Softbank’s Kaikaku fund in the Philippines. Srini has closed US $5.0 bn+ worth of transactions in the areas of project finance, corporate finance, private placement of capital, direct investments, leverage buy outs and mergers and acquisitions covering countries in South East Asia and India.

Srini is a member of Federation of Indian Chamber of Commerce in the Philippines, ASEAN India Business Council. Srini is also a member of Indian Institute of Technology Alumni chapters of Singapore and the USA.

Srini serves on the boards of several public and private companies. Srini currently serves on the board of Hunter Technology Corp. (a TSX listed company) and Oasis Financial Services Group (formerly IP Egames Ventures, a PSE listed company) as director and audit committee chairman.

Srini did his Masters in Business Management at the Asian Institute of Management in Manila, Philippines, and Masters in Technology from the Indian Institute of Technology, Kharagpur, India. Srini also attended an exchange program at Desautels Graduate School of Business Management, McGill University, Montreal, Canada.

Enrique Gonzalez

Managing Director
Manila

Enrique is a leading Philippine entrepreneur with businesses in healthcare services, retail, technology, cybersecurity, F&B, real estate and Fintech.

Enrique founded and listed 3 companies on the Philippine Stock Exchange (PSE). He has also led joint-ventures and co-investments with Softbank, Tencent, PCCW of Hong Kong, GMA7 and Philippine Star. Enrique was involved in a number of acquisitions, divestitures and strategic investment transactions since 2006.

Enrique successfully brought a number of international brands to the Philippines such as NBA, Highlands Coffee, Western Union and MYEG.
Enrique attended the OPM program at Harvard Business School. Enrique is the first Kauffman Fellow from the Philippines. Enrique did his undergraduate studies from Middlebury College. Enrique was the finalist of E&Y Entrepreneur of the Year in the Philippines.
